Show Description:
In his book "A Spiritual Hitchhiker's Guide to the Universe", author Paul Rademacher brings us a text for spiritual seekers looking to transcend traditional churches, temples and synagogues. A former minister, Paul Rademacher describes his own spiritual journey, using the Bible as a jumping off point to explore the idea of enlightenment. He goes from his Sunday school roots, to his days pouring concrete and his surprising decision to become a minister.
After examining his own religious beliefs, Rademacher found that churches often focused too heavily on eternity - what happens when we die. The rightful focus of any true spiritual path, he came to believe, should be on infinity - how to experience the fullness of our divinity in the here and now. Rademacher has succeeded in writing both a deeply personal memoir and a meditation on the greater meaning of authentic spirituality.

Guest Bio:
Paul Rademacher is a former Presbyterian minister, a graduate of Princeton Divinity School, and current executive director of the Monroe Institue in Virginia. The Monroe Institute in world reknowned for the exploration of human consciousness.
